Ukrainian Drone Attack Causes Fatal Fire in Russian Shopping Center

Date:

A Ukrainian drone shot down over Vladikavkaz, Russia, caused a deadly shopping center fire Wednesday after falling debris triggered an explosion, according to North Ossetia regional governor Sergei Menyailo. The incident, occurring at 0828 Moscow time, resulted in one woman’s death.

Russia’s Defense Ministry reports intercepting 119 Ukrainian drones within the previous 24 hours, highlighting escalating aerial attacks. The Vladikavkaz incident marks another civilian casualty in the ongoing conflict.

Ukraine has not commented on the incident, and Reuters could not independently verify the governor’s claims.
